  • How is the weather in Notre Dame?

    Notre Dame has cold winters with temperatures ranging from 17–36°F (-8–2°C), and warm, humid summers reaching 62–83°F (17–28°C). Spring and fall bring mild weather, so layering works well for changing conditions.

  • What are the best places to visit in Notre Dame?

    Notre Dame has landmarks like the Golden Dome, the Basilica of the Sacred Heart, and the Grotto of Our Lady of Lourdes. Around campus, the Raclin Murphy Museum of Art and the university's lakes are also frequently suggested stops.

  • What is Notre Dame known for?

    Notre Dame is widely known for its historic university, distinctive campus architecture, and collegiate sports traditions. Many recognize the Golden Dome, Basilica of the Sacred Heart, and vibrant campus life.
